Aussie-Made Rooftop Renegade Release Date Set For February

Get your rocket-powered skates on this February

Rooftop Renegade, the side-scrolling platformer from South Australian developer Melonhead Games will launch on February 17 the studio has announced.

Beginning development in 2018 as part of a Global Game Jam, the team at Melonhead has been hard at work on the title, with the game recognised as part of PAX Australia’s Indie Showcase in 2022.

Rooftop Renegade is set in a cyberpunk world and sees you wear the rocket-powered skates of Svetlana, engaging in fast-paced platforming as she avoids being captured by Globalcorp. Local multiplayer of up to four players will be included, where three players will take on the role as Globalcorp gunners.

Rooftop Renegade releases on February 17 on PS4, Xbox One, Nintendo Switch and PC.
